一般描述
对称脂肪族三烷基锍阳离子在室温下可与双(三氟甲基磺酰)亚胺形成熔盐。
应用
Triethylsulfonium bis(trifluoromethylsulfonyl)imide is a room-temperature ionic liquid (RTIL ) that can be used:
- As an electrolyte in electrochemical double-layer supercapacitors.
- As a model ionic liquid used in the studies of structure effect of ions on electrochemical windows (EWs).
- As a component of the gel polymer electrolyte, which is used in the construction of symmetrical electrical-double layer capacitors.
- As an electrolyte in the in-plane supercapacitor devices.
